Boston, MA – Today, I caught up with 2:29 marathoner Stephanie Rothstein Bruce for a quick interview. The video is embedded below.

Rothstein, who set a PR at the NYC Half (70:53) and was 3rd place at the US 15k champs leading into this race, was upbeat about her prospects for Monday:

“(My training cycle) has been good. That’s a little scary. Sometimes I feel when everything is going together you’re like (thinking), ‘The only thing I can do is mess this up right now.'”

“I feel like things are kind of right where they want to be and we’ll see where ‘Lady Marathon Luck’ is on Monday.”
